Intravitreous Cutaneous Metastatic Melanoma in the Era of Checkpoint Inhibition: Unmasking and Masquerading

Metastatic cutaneous melanoma to the vitreous is rare but can occur, especially with immune checkpoint inhibition treatment. Ophthalmic treatments exist, but visual outcomes are often poor, necessitating evaluation by an ophthalmic oncologist.

Background:

  • Metastatic cutaneous melanoma to the vitreous is an exceptionally rare clinical presentation.
  • The advent of immune checkpoint inhibition has potentially altered the landscape of metastatic melanoma, including ocular involvement.

Purpose of the Study:

  • To investigate the clinical findings, treatment strategies, and outcomes for patients with metastatic cutaneous melanoma to the vitreous.
  • To explore the significance of immune checkpoint inhibition in the context of vitreous metastasis from cutaneous melanoma.

Main Methods:

  • A multicenter, retrospective cohort study was conducted.
  • Clinical records of 11 patients (14 eyes) with metastatic cutaneous melanoma to the vitreous were reviewed.
  • Data collected included clinical features, ophthalmic and systemic treatments, and patient outcomes.

Main Results:

  • The median age at presentation was 66 years, with a median follow-up of 23 months.
  • Ten of 11 patients received immune checkpoint inhibition, with a median of 17 months from immunotherapy initiation to ocular symptoms.
  • Ophthalmic findings included amelanotic vitreous debris, elevated intraocular pressure, and retinal detachment; visual acuity outcomes were varied, with many eyes showing poor visual potential.

Conclusions:

  • Vitreous debris in metastatic cutaneous melanoma patients warrants consideration of intravitreal metastasis, particularly during immune checkpoint inhibitor therapy.
  • Treatment options include external beam radiation, intravitreous melphalan, and systemic checkpoint inhibition, though neovascular glaucoma and retinal detachments are potential complications.
  • Early evaluation by an ophthalmic oncologist is recommended for patients with visual symptoms or vitreous debris in the setting of metastatic cutaneous melanoma.

Skin Cancer

Skin cancer is a type of cancer that occurs when there is an abnormal growth of skin cells, usually triggered by damage to the DNA within the skin cells. It is primarily caused by exposure to ultraviolet (UV) radiation from the sun or artificial sources like tanning beds. Skin cancer is the most common type of cancer worldwide, and its incidence continues to rise.
